Table 15: Fiber Standards
ITU-T Standard
Description
Application
G.651
Multimode Fiber
50/125-micron core
Short-reach connections in the
1300-nm or 850-nm band.
G.652
Non-Dispersion-Shifted Fiber
Single-mode, 9/125-micron core
Longer spans and extended reach.
Optimized for operation in the 1310-
nm band. but can also be used in the
1550-nm band.
G.652.C
Low Water Peak Non-Dispersion-
Shifted Fiber
Single-mode, 9/125-micron core
Longer spans and extended reach.
Optimized for wavelength-division
multiplexing (WDM) transmission
across wavelengths from 1285 to
1625 nm. The zero dispersion
wavelength is in the 1310-nm
region.
G.653
Dispersion-Shifted Fiber
Single-mode, 9/125-micron core
Longer spans and extended reach.
Optimized for operation in the region
from 1500 to 1600-nm.
G.654
1550-nm Loss-Minimized Fiber
Single-mode, 9/125-micron core
Extended long-haul applications.
Optimized for high-power
transmission in the 1500 to 1600-nm
region, with low loss in the 1550-nm
band.
G.655
Non-Zero Dispersion-Shifted Fiber
Single-mode, 9/125-micron core
Extended long-haul applications.
Optimized for high-power dense
wavelength-division multiplexing
(DWDM) operation in the region from
1500 to 1600-nm.
